Sterilization describes a process that destroys or removes all sorts of microbial lifestyle and is also performed in well being-treatment facilities by Bodily or chemical approaches. Steam stressed, dry warmth, EtO fuel, hydrogen peroxide gas plasma, and liquid chemical compounds will be the principal sterilizing agents Utilized in health and fitness-treatment services. Sterilization is meant to Express an absolute that means; however, nonetheless, some health and fitness specialists and also the technical and commercial literature confer with “disinfection” as “sterilization” and products as “partially sterile.” When chemical substances are used to wipe out all forms of microbiologic daily life, they can be referred to as chemical sterilants.
